National Reading Month

March is National Reading Month, let's raise a collective cheer for the volunteers of Literations! Together, you're building a world where every child has the opportunity to explore, imagine, and thrive through the power of reading.


Your team will receive a stack of Literations reading logs next week to share with your students, encouraging them to write down all the great books they read throughout March. You, too, can share what you're reading in your spare time and why you love to read. Talking to children about what you're reading sends the signal that reading is important (and enjoyable!) at every age.
